About: I have always lived with and cared for cats and dogs my whole life, but I have also have several positions over the past 15 years caring for various other animals. My first professional animal caregiving experience was at Pioneer Park Nature Center in Lincoln, NE. There, I provided enrichment and care to a wild variety of animals, including owls, hawks, vultures, snakes, turtles, and salamanders. I have also lived on farms where I cared for dogs, rabbits, goats, sheep, ducks, and chickens. In California, I volunteered for 2 years at a wildlife hospital where I cared mainly for songbirds. There, I learned how to administer medication and provide foster care for baby squirrels and raccoons. The care of animals has always been central to my personal, professional, and even my academic life. I love all animals, but I am by far a cat person. I grew up with five cats and two dogs. Currently, I have a sweet old man cat named Little One. I have a lot of availability because I work seasonal, conducting bird surveys for a non-profit in Idaho in the spring and summer. I am happy to do evening walks, overnights, holidays, and weekends. I am a responsible, respectful adult who is happy to care for your pet at your home, as my living situation is not conducive to boarding animals.
